Hermann Bauer (22 July 1875—11 February 1958) was an officer in the Imperial German Navy.
Life & Career
Between November 1913 and March 1914 Bauer commanded the light cruiser Hamburg.
He was appointed command of the battleship Westfalen from 24/7/1917 - 5/8/1918.[1]
He was appointed command of the battleship Kaiser from 6/8/1918 - 5/11/1918.[2]
He was appointed command of the battleship Oldenburg.[3]
He was appointed command of the battleship Nassau from 11/11/1918 - 20/12/1918.[4]
